How to create different measures with different dimensions in one table

Hi All, 

My question is, I have one table.

In that table I have 7 dimensions....

Line of business 

Group 

Category 

Premium type 

Premium type new

Business category 

Par non par

In that table I want to creat two measures like 

1. No. Of Policies 

2. Premium 

In No. Of Policies measure I want total policies based on all 6 dimensions except Premium type new dimension 

In Premium measure I want total premium based on all 6 dimensions except Premium type dimension....

Please help how tackle this...

Hi @SNShinde 

try to do something like this- 

create two flag,

one  for 6 Dim except Premium type new,

 and Second for 6 dimensions except Premium type dimension.

 

and when you create the measure enter to set analysis of the flags according to condition.
